Physical and Psychological Demands
The physical workload of hot paramedics includes lifting patients, working in adverse weather, and operating in crowded or unsafe scenes. Psychological demands stem from high-stakes decision-making, exposure to severe injury, and frequent interactions with distressed patients and families.
Agencies increasingly recognize the need for structured support, including peer counseling, clinical debriefs, and resilience training, to mitigate burnout and compassion fatigue. These resources help sustain performance across long shifts and recurring traumatic exposures.
Clinical Scope and Medication Protocols
Hot paramedics operate under standing orders that authorize advanced airway management, sedation, vasoactive infusions, and rapid sequence intubation when clinically indicated. Protocols emphasize continuous reassessment, integrating vital signs, patient history, and real-time communication with medical control.
- Advanced cardiac life support algorithms tailored to emergency department handoff criteria.
- Pain management and procedural sedation checklists aligned with regional formularies.
- Trauma triage tools that integrate mechanism of injury, anatomical findings, and physiological parameters.
- Pediatric and geriatric adaptations of standard drug dosing and airway techniques.
Training, Certification, and Career Pathways
Entry-level practice requires national certification, continuing education, and simulation-based refreshers focused on maintaining psychomotor skills. Many hot paramedics pursue specialty qualifications in tactical EMS, critical care transport, or disaster response to expand their clinical versatility.
Career advancement often involves mentorship roles, quality improvement initiatives, and participation in protocol development, reinforcing a culture of evidence-based prehospital care.

How do hot paramedics maintain safety at chaotic scenes?
They apply structured scene size-up, dynamic risk-benefit analysis, and communication with law enforcement or fire teams to balance rapid care with personal safety.
What is the typical patient profile for a hot paramedic shift?
They frequently manage trauma, cardiac, and respiratory emergencies, with a high proportion of interfacility transfers and time-sensitive critical care interventions.
How are medication errors prevented during high-pressure calls?
Double-check protocols, barcode medication verification where available, and standardized time-out procedures help reduce errors despite urgent time constraints.
What support exists for mental health after difficult calls?
Most services provide confidential counseling, peer support networks, and mandatory debriefs to process difficult events and monitor cumulative stress.
